[GastForen Programmierung/Entwicklung PHP und MySQL formular zur erstllung mysql-tabllen

  • Suche
  • Hilfe
  • Lesezeichen
  • Benutzerliste
Themen
Beiträge
Moderatoren
Letzter Beitrag

formular zur erstllung mysql-tabllen

pat87
Beiträge gesamt: 581

18. Jun 2004, 16:03
Beitrag # 1 von 3
Bewertung:
(390 mal gelesen)
URL zum Beitrag
Beitrag als Lesezeichen
hallo zusammen,

ich habe mir mal ein script geschrieben, mit dem ich mir mysql-tabellen einrichten kann. nun meine frage: wie kann ich es einstellen, dass ich eine beliebige anzahl felder (anzahl muss eingegeben werden) mit unterschiedlichen feldnamen (welche ich auch in das formular eingeben kann) ertellt.

hier mal das script:

<?
echo '<!-- nur wo html draufsteht ist auch html drinn -->
<!-- aber wo php draufsteht ist auch html drinn -->

<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">

<html>';
echo '<head>';
echo '<meta name="author" content="pat">';
echo '<meta name="keywords" content="pat, pat87, pat87.ch, patrick, buff, 87">';
echo '<meta http-equiv="content-type" content="text/html;charset=ISO-8859-1">';
echo '<link rel="stylesheet" type="text/css" href="style.css">';
echo '<title>pat87.ch</title>';
echo '<link rel="SHORTCUT ICON" href="http://www.pat87.ch/...s/favicon.ico">';
echo '</head>';
echo '<body>';
echo '<form action="install.php" method="post">';
echo '<input type="text" size="17" name="database_table">';
echo '<input type="submit" value="OK">';
echo '</form>';

$db=mysql_connect(localhost,pat,*******);
mysql_select_db(pat);
$anfrage="CREATE TABLE $database_table (feld1 VARCHAR(50),feld2 VARCHAR(20), feld3 VARCHAR(50))";
mysql_query($anfrage);
mysql_close($db);
echo "tabelle '$database_table' erfolgreich eingerichtet";

echo '</body>';
echo '</html>';
?>

ich denke, dass es möglich ist, wenn ich das selbe script aufrufe.

mfg p@
---
mailto:admin@pat87.ch
http://www.pat87.ch/
X

formular zur erstllung mysql-tabllen

oesi50
  
Beiträge gesamt: 2315

18. Jun 2004, 16:21
Beitrag # 2 von 3
Beitrag ID: #91909
Bewertung:
(390 mal gelesen)
URL zum Beitrag
Beitrag als Lesezeichen
Das geht ungefähr so:

1. Formular mit Frage nach Anzahl der Felder
2. dynamisch erzeugtes Formular anzeigen
3. Daten prüfen, Tabelle anlegen, Meldung

Die Schritte 1 bis 3 können separate Scripte sein, oder ein gesamtes zustandsgesteuertes Programm("endlicher Automat").

Grüße Oesi
Ich weiß, dass ich nichts weiß... (Sokrates)


als Antwort auf: [#91903]

formular zur erstllung mysql-tabllen

pat87
Beiträge gesamt: 581

18. Jun 2004, 18:28
Beitrag # 3 von 3
Beitrag ID: #91935
Bewertung:
(390 mal gelesen)
URL zum Beitrag
Beitrag als Lesezeichen
was meinst du mit 'endlicher Automat'?

mfg p@
---
mailto:admin@pat87.ch
http://www.pat87.ch/


als Antwort auf: [#91903]